  We enjoyed the college student who guide us on the tour but it is really more like a history lesson with some ghost stories told along the way. Also, we did not know that we were not going to be going in to the residential area or inside any buildings at all. They are not allowed to tour the residential area after 5:00 pm and we only looked in places from the outside. We also did the old city jail tour and it was a bit more interesting because we got to go inside the building and it is a pretty spooky looking place from the outside too.
